Description
Easy Blueberry Pie Bombs are irresistibly simple treats made with biscuit dough and blueberry filling, perfect for a snack, dessert, or breakfast.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 can refrigerated biscuit dough (8 biscuits)
- 1 cup blueberry pie filling (or fresh blueberries tossed with sugar & cornstarch)
- 1 egg, beaten (for egg wash)
- Optional: powdered sugar glaze (½ cup powdered sugar + 1–2 tbsp milk)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Flatten each biscuit into a 3–4 inch round.
- Spoon 1 tbsp of blueberry pie filling into the center.
- Carefully fold edges over filling and pinch tightly to seal.
- Place seam-side down on prepared baking sheet.
- Brush tops with beaten egg for a golden finish.
- Bake 12–15 minutes, until golden brown and puffed.
- Whisk together powdered sugar and milk for glaze (optional).
- Drizzle glaze over warm pie bombs.
- Enjoy warm as a snack, dessert, or breakfast treat!
Notes
- For a fresher taste, use fresh blueberries with sugar and cornstarch instead of pie filling.
- Adjust the sweetness of the glaze according to your preference.
